The Growing Importance of Soft Skills in Modern Careers

The workplace has changed significantly over the years. Companies now look for professionals who can combine technical expertise with interpersonal abilities. A candidate may have excellent qualifications, but without confidence, teamwork skills, and effective communication, it can become difficult to reach higher career positions.

Industries such as information technology, healthcare, education, marketing, and customer service require professionals who can interact with different types of people. Managers need employees who can adapt quickly, solve problems, and contribute positively to organizational goals.

Soft skills help professionals create better workplace relationships and improve productivity. Skills such as active listening, leadership, negotiation, time management, and problem-solving are valuable across almost every career path.

Key Areas of Personality Development

Personality development is a continuous process that focuses on improving different aspects of an individual’s behavior and mindset. Some important areas include:

Communication Skills

Clear communication is one of the most important skills in professional life. Being able to share ideas confidently, listen carefully, and respond appropriately can make a significant difference in personal interactions.

Strong communication helps professionals avoid misunderstandings and build trust with colleagues, customers, and business partners.

Confidence and Self-Awareness

Confidence allows individuals to express their thoughts without hesitation. However, true confidence comes from understanding personal strengths, identifying areas for improvement, and continuously working on growth.

Self-aware individuals are better able to manage their emotions, accept feedback, and make thoughtful decisions.

Leadership Qualities

Leadership is not limited to people managing large teams. Every professional can demonstrate leadership by taking responsibility, supporting others, and showing initiative.

Organizations appreciate employees who can handle challenges independently and contribute innovative solutions.

Emotional Intelligence

Emotional intelligence refers to the ability to understand and manage emotions effectively. Professionals with strong emotional intelligence can handle workplace pressure, maintain positive relationships, and respond calmly during difficult situations.

Practical Ways to Improve Your Personality and Professional Skills

Improving soft skills requires regular practice and dedication. Some effective methods include:

Practice Public Speaking

Speaking in front of others helps reduce hesitation and improves confidence. Individuals can start by participating in group discussions, presentations, or professional events.

Read and Learn Regularly

Reading books, articles, and industry-related content improves vocabulary, knowledge, and critical thinking abilities. It also helps individuals develop better conversation skills.

Accept Constructive Feedback

Feedback provides valuable insights into areas that need improvement. Professionals who accept feedback positively are more likely to grow faster in their careers.

Improve Body Language

Non-verbal communication influences how people perceive confidence and professionalism. Maintaining eye contact, using appropriate gestures, and having positive body language can create a strong impression.

Develop a Growth Mindset

A growth mindset encourages individuals to see challenges as opportunities for learning. This approach helps professionals stay motivated and adaptable in changing work environments.

Real-World Impact of Strong Soft Skills

Many successful professionals achieve career growth not only because of their technical expertise but also because of their ability to communicate, collaborate, and lead effectively.

For example, a software developer may need to explain complex technical solutions to clients or team members. A marketing professional may need to negotiate with customers and understand their requirements. A manager must motivate employees and resolve conflicts.

In each situation, soft skills determine how effectively a person can apply their knowledge. This is why organizations invest in employee development programs focused on communication, leadership, and workplace behavior.
